CKLA Teacher Level deidentified
Part of Project: Efficacy of the Core Knowledge Language Arts Read-Aloud Program in Kindergarten through First Grade Classrooms
Description: This data set is a wide file that merges all of the CKLA data sets at the teacher level. It focuses on the variables most likely to be analyzed. Although this is a teacher-level file, we include teacher aggregates of student measures in this data set. This file includes one case for each teacher.
Investigators: Sonia Q. Cabell, Thomas G. White, James S. Kim, HyeJin Hwang, Ansley Kramer, Marcy Wyatt, Tara Reynolds, C.J. Espittia, Sen Wang, Ashley Edwards, Jamie DeCoster, Jamie Quinn, Rhonda Raines, Elizabeth Hadley

Pre- and Post Retell & Inferential Vocab Data AND Repeated Acquisition Design Data for Taught Words
Part of Project: Oral Academic Narrative Language Intervention
Description: This file contains data according to two research designs: small scale RCT and a Repeated Acquisition Design (single case research). The vocabulary at the pre- and post- collections were untaught words whereas the weekly probes for the RAD were the taught words of that week.
Investigators: Trina D. Spencer

Meta-Analysis Codebook of Final Articles with Effect Sizes, Sample Sizes, and Moderators
Part of Project: The Home Math Environment and Children's Math Achievment: A Meta-Analysis
Description: The data are in long form, with some studies having multiple lines and includes a sample of children ranging from 3.54 to 13.75 years old. The main effect size is the r, correlation coefficient, and the accompanying sample size is also included.
Investigators: Dr. Amy R. Napoli, Dr. Jamie M. Quinn, Dr. Sarah G. Wood, Mia C. Daucourt, Sara A. Hart

Preschool Social and Emotional Development Study—Connecticut Dataset
Part of Project: Preschool Social and Emotional Development Study
Description: These data are children ages 2 through 5, includes preschool, child, and family demographic characters, social and emotional skills, cognitive skills, early math, early reading, and other indicators of kindergarten readiness (e.g., approaches to learning). Data were collected via director child assessments and teacher report.
Investigators: Craig Bailey, İrem Korucu, Abi Eveleigh, Gina Schnur, Lauren Costello, Meghan Tuttle, Terrance Knox-Lane, Colleen Cassidy, Ashlin Ondrusek, Tessa McNaboe, Anushay Mazhar, Fuzhe Xie

WRRMP Full data (all waves)
Part of Project: Western Reserve Reading and Math Project
Description: This dataset contains all longitudinal data for the entirety of the WRRMP. This includes 10 waves worth of twin data, with extensive reading, math, behavioral, and environmental measures. Due to the twin nature of the data, data is presented as both long and wide, with each twin represented twice within the dataset.
Investigators: Stephen Petrill, Lee Thompson, Robert Plomin, Laura Segebart DeThorne, Chris Schatschneider
